Nuki Bluetooth API
Project description
pyNukiBT
Nuki Bluetooth API
This is only a python API implementation of the Bluetooth communication with Nuki lock. It is not intended to be used as a stand alone solution, only as a library that can be used by other solutions (like the RaspiNukiBridge web Nuki-Bridge implementation or the hass_nuki_bt Home Assistant component)
Background
- This is based on RaspiNukiBridge by dauden1184 and RaspiNukiBridge regevbr
- Nuki documentation
Important - if you are experiencing delays using RPI, it is advised to use a bluetooth dongle instead of the builtin bluetooth hardware. TP-LINK UB400 is verified to be working.
Raspberry Pi 3B+ and 4 only
It might be necessary to DOWNGRADE Bluez. See comment.
wget http://ftp.hk.debian.org/debian/pool/main/b/bluez/bluez_5.50-1.2~deb10u2_armhf.deb sudo apt install ./bluez_5.50-1.2~deb10u2_armhf.deb
Reboot the Raspberry Pi
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file pynukibt-0.0.16.tar.gz
.
File metadata
- Download URL: pynukibt-0.0.16.tar.gz
- Upload date:
- Size: 19.9 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/5.1.1 CPython/3.12.7
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| b109ef136aa831ef0588bad05d30d1adaaf7caacb7804024967509ec88410cc6 |
|
MD5 | f3de691f531434b0061ba7ba73c05b54 |
|
BLAKE2b-256 | 6602ed5c8f07a1092691ee75c1b6ef1648cb7b2d30518481982f7076c1bf3789 |
File details
Details for the file pyNukiBT-0.0.16-py3-none-any.whl
.
File metadata
- Download URL: pyNukiBT-0.0.16-py3-none-any.whl
- Upload date:
- Size: 17.5 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/5.1.1 CPython/3.12.7
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| fde165f86646164bf25a3f3ed049166c56166cd61b4148f5a393d3dec775c440 |
|
MD5 | eaa0b2e2b9e29577f016c4013b17fe29 |
|
BLAKE2b-256 | e8b01a785d137aa558c637724c79e33df15d3efa60e8db287ed79e1eba69e88d |